In the strong orange luminescent material of [Pb(bp4mo)Cl2], two different types of octahedra, namely PbCl4N2 and PbCl4O2, are bridged by the N-oxide-4,4′-bipyridine (bp4mo) ligand, while its protonated form, Hbp4mo+, coordinates to Pb2+ center only with the N-oxide group in [Pb(Hbp4mo)2Cl2](NO3)2. Important relationships between structures and luminescence properties are revealed.
